Inhalt aus einer anderen WordPress-Installationsdatenbank in der Seitenvorlagenschleife anzeigen?

Ich frage mich nur, ob es möglich ist, nur den Seiteninhalt einer anderen WordPress-database auf WordPress-Seiten mit derselben PageID innerhalb der Inhaltsschleife in meiner Seitenvorlage anzuzeigen. Um genauer zu sein, möchte ich den Inhalt einer separaten WordPress-database in einer anderen WordPress-Installation zeigen, ohne sie zu duplizieren. Es ist nur der Seiteninhalt, den ich bekommen möchte, also werden keine Artikel benötigt. Die Struktur und die Seiten-IDs der beiden WordPress-Installationen sind identisch.

Ich möchte die database mit $ wpdb adressieren, habe aber keine Ahnung, wie ich mit diesem Problem umgehen soll und ob es überhaupt möglich ist, es zu lösen.


edit: Sie sind nicht die gleiche Domain. Und danke für das Kommentieren, Kaiser! Ich möchte zwei separate, identische WordPress-Installationen haben, die den Seiteninhalt einer einzelnen database teilen, aber ihre individuellen lokalen Einstellungen (lokale database), Themen und Stile beibehalten. Wie gesagt, die Struktur der Seiten (Navigation, Seiten-IDs) ist identisch. In diesem Fall verwende ich WordPress eher wie ein CMS und dann ein Blog-System, und die Medienbibliothek wird über CDN geliefert, so dass Medieninhalte kein Problem in geteilten Inhalten darstellen.

Meine erste Idee war, $ wpdb in meine Seitenvorlage zu bekommen, um den Inhalt der externen database zu bekommen. Aber das würde bedeuten, den Seiteninhalt nach Seiten-ID zu adressieren, oder?


edit2: Folgendes habe ich heute versucht:

get_results($query, OBJECT); foreach($myposts as $mypost) echo "{$mypost->post_content}"; ?> 

Ich habe diesen Code in meine Seitenvorlage eingefügt und habe sogar die post_content-Ausgabe erhalten. Aber soweit es mich betrifft, ist das NICHT, wonach ich gesucht habe. Shortcodes werden nicht analysiert, und die performance kann ebenfalls ein Problem sein.

Wissen Sie irgendeinen möglichen Weg, wie WordPress Shortcodes, die aus einer externen database empfangen wurden, analysiert? Wie gesagt, die beiden WordPress-Installationen sind identisch, so dass alle shortcodes in jeder functions.php gut definiert sind.

Vielen Dank!

Solutions Collecting From Web of "Inhalt aus einer anderen WordPress-Installationsdatenbank in der Seitenvorlagenschleife anzeigen?"

Auf deinem Edit2:

Wenn es genau das gleiche ist, könnten Sie hinzufügen

 echo apply_filters('the_content', {$mypost->post_content}); 

den Filter “_content” anwenden, um die Shortcodes zu analysieren?

Warum nicht die Multi-Site-function von WordPress verwenden? Wenn so viel identisch ist, scheint es einfacher zu aktualisieren, wenn Ihr Code nicht doppelt vorhanden ist. Und für geteilte Inhalte könntest du dann get_blog_post () verwenden. Sie können weiterhin einzelnen Domains zuordnen, sodass Sie Ihre URL-Unterschiede haben.